Transaction ff0ac9075e34a57eaa4fad160c85dbd64684bdd192d6f402a64718a2964e69a3

1 Input
2 Outputs
  • ff0ac9075e34a57eaa4fad160c85dbd64684bdd192d6f402a64718a2964e69a3:0
  • value  3473670
    address  3JGHm6HUUbSjw8bbt8yFcDMMTcVjDWEVpx
  • ff0ac9075e34a57eaa4fad160c85dbd64684bdd192d6f402a64718a2964e69a3:1
  • value  107403307
    address  1N8apZvhRV9xtvBBUhq5i9MByXRt2CQrBD